This discovery kit is ideal for when you want to learn about and develop solutions for the IoT and applications involving direct connection to cloud servers. By exploiting low-power multi-channel communications, multiway sensing, and the STM32L4 microcontroller, the kit enables a diversity of applications. In addition, support for the Arduino UNO V3, and PMOD connectivity, provides unlimited expansion capabilities with a large choice of specialised add-on boards.
The kit is based around ultra-low power STM32L4 series MCUs that are based on ARM Cortex -M4 core with 1Mbyte of Flash memory and 128Kbytes of SRAM. The board supports a wide choice of Integrated Development Environments (IDEs) including IAR , Keil , GCC-based IDEs, ARM mbed Enabled. Additional features of this comprehensively equipped board include:
Bluetooth V4.1
Wi-Fi
2x Digital omnidirectional microphones
Capacitive digital sensor for relative humidity and temperature
High-performance 3-axis magnetometer
3D Accelerometer and 3D gyroscope
260 to 1260hPa Absolute digital output barometer
Time-of-Flight and gesture-detection sensor

- Operating frequency 915MHz
- 64-Mbit Quad-SPI Flash memory
- Dynamic NFC tag based on M24SR with its printed NFC antenna
- 2x Push-buttons (user and reset)
- USB OTG FS with Micro-AB connector
- Expansion connectors Arduino Uno V3 and PMOD
- Power supply ST LINK USB VBUS or external source
- On-board ST-LINK/V2-1 debugger/programmer
- Comprehensive free software HAL library
- ARM mbed Enabled
